2025-04-22Colorize code blocks.Taylor Mullen
- This changeset uses lowlight.js to parse the code in codeblocks to derive an AST, it then translates that into CSS themes that are widely known via highlight.js (things that GitHub use), finally I translate those css.color attributes into Ink colors and effectivel do <Text color={the color}>the text</Text>. - To do this I needed to build color mappings from css -> Ink - I introduced a new `Theme` type that will be used to represent many different color themes. It also enabled the color mappings to be seamless. - Added a theme manager that only has one theme for now (VS2015). The theme works very well with our colorization. - Some other bits was removal of borders around our codeblocks since they now have richer rendering. - Most complex bits of code in this PR is in the `CodeColorizer.tsx` Fixes https://b.corp.google.com/issues/412433479

2025-04-17Initial commit of Gemini Code CLITaylor Mullen
This commit introduces the initial codebase for the Gemini Code CLI, a command-line interface designed to facilitate interaction with the Gemini API for software engineering tasks. The code was migrated from a previous git repository as a single squashed commit. Core Features & Components: * **Gemini Integration:** Leverages the `@google/genai` SDK to interact with the Gemini models, supporting chat history, streaming responses, and function calling (tools). * **Terminal UI:** Built with Ink (React for CLIs) providing an interactive chat interface within the terminal, including input prompts, message display, loading indicators, and tool interaction elements. * **Tooling Framework:** Implements a robust tool system allowing Gemini to interact with the local environment. Includes tools for: * File system listing (`ls`) * File reading (`read-file`) * Content searching (`grep`) * File globbing (`glob`) * File editing (`edit`) * File writing (`write-file`) * Executing bash commands (`terminal`) * **State Management:** Handles the streaming state of Gemini responses and manages the conversation history. * **Configuration:** Parses command-line arguments (`yargs`) and loads environment variables (`dotenv`) for setup. * **Project Structure:** Organized into `core`, `ui`, `tools`, `config`, and `utils` directories using TypeScript. Includes basic build (`tsc`) and start scripts.
